From: New gorilla adenovirus vaccine vectors induce potent immune responses and protection in a mouse malaria model

Fig. 2

T cell and antibody responses induced by a single immunization of HuAd5-PyCSP, GC44-PyCSP, GC45-PyCSP or GC46-PyCSP. BALB/c mice (6 mice/group) were immunized with three different doses (1 × 107, 1 × 108 or 1 × 109 pu) of HuAd5 Null, HuAd5-PyCSP, GC44-PyCSP, GC45-PyCSP or GC46-PyCSP. a CD8+ T cell IFN-γ responses were assessed 21 days after immunization by ICS. Splenocytes were stimulated with A20.2J cells loaded with peptides encoding the PyCSP immunodominant CD8+ T cell epitope (amino acids 280–288), the PyCSP immunodominant CD4+/nested CD8+ subdominant T cell epitopes (amino acids 57–70) or the influenza hemagglutinin CD8+ T cell epitope (amino acids 332–240). Error bars indicate standard errors of the means (n = 6). *p <0.05 compared with HuAd5 at the same dose. b PyCSP-specific antibody responses were assessed 21 days after immunization by ELISA. The capture antigen was purified PyCSP protein. The values for individual mice are shown (n = 6). The mean is indicated by the black line. *p <0.05 compared with HuAd5 at the same dose
